Unstolen

Part of Speech: Adjective

Sense: Not stolen; not taken unlawfully

Usage 1:

Bob was relieved to find his car unstolen after accidentally leaving the keys in the ignition.

Usage 2:

The museum proudly displayed an unstolen masterpiece that had never been a target of thieves.
